Resources to help seniors with the energy crunch

 


Golden Umbrella:  Shasta County Utility customers may receive emergency assistance through the Power To Seniors program if they are 62 years old or older, and meet income guidelines.  Must have a shut off notice or their utilities have been shut off.  You may call  (530) 223-6034 to see if you qualify.

 

Energy Assistance

 

Help with Utility Bills

CARES (Community Assistance for Redding Electric Service - City of Redding)

Once every two years assistance only (shut off notice may be required). You may call (530) 339-7200 or come to their office at 777 Cypress Ave., Redding.

 

City of Redding Utilities

Budget billing (provides for equal monthly payments to qualified residential customers) or amortization program (provides a method of paying an existing balance over time to qualified residential customers).  Call (530) 245-7200 to find out if you qualify for any of these programs.

 

City of Redding Lifeline Program

Applications available by calling (530) 339-7200 Monday-Friday from 8am - 5pm. Must be 62 and over or disabled. The maximum benefit is 20% discount of the first 600 Kilowatt-hours, up to the maximum of $13.54 per month. The deduction will appear on your monthly bill. 1 person - $1614 per month or less. 2 persons - $1764 per month or less. 3 persons - $1914 per month or less. 4 persons - $2064 or less. PG&E - CARES Program

Alternate Rates for Energy - Applications available by calling 1-800-743-5000 or at Golden Umbrella. Provides a discount off monthly bill. 1 or 2 person in household $22,000 per month or less. 3 people $26,600, 4 people $32,000, add $5000 per person. Should inquire about a payment plan.  Rates may also be negotiated to persons with documented extensive medical needs.

 

REACH (Relief for Energy Assistance through Community Help - PG&E)

One-time assistance only. Must have a shut-off notice, can pay up to $200 for those customers whose income for a household of 2 persons at or below $1,875 per month. (No HUD recipients) Call the Salvation Army, Monday-Friday from 1-3pm. (530) 222-2207

 

SHARE (City of Shasta Lake)

Must have a shut-off notice. Provides $100 discount off utilities per year for qualifying City of Shasta Lake electric customers. Call the Salvation Army from 1-3pm. (530) 222-2207 

 

HEAP (Home Energy Assistance Program) - Available 2/1/01

Provides once a year assistance for income-eligible customers.  Telephone applications are taken Tuesdays 1-4 pm; 

for wood, oil, and propane, Tuesday mornings 

8 - 11 am. Call (530) 378-6900 for more information.

 

PROPANE USERS

Should inquire about a payment plan or refer to HEAP for one time assistance.

 

Home Improvement

SELF HELP HOME IMPROVEMENT PROJECT (SHHIP):

ENERGY PARTNERS FOR WEATHERIZATION

Assistance with free weatherization to income-qualified customers. For PG&E customers only. Call (530) 378-6900 

 

FURNACE PROGRAM

Assistance is available for furnace repair or replacement to income-qualified customers. Call (530) 378-6900 

 

SELF-HELP LOANS

Low interest loans available at 1% over 20 years for weatherization. (530) 378-6900 

 

REDDING RANCHERIA

Help for Native American customers. Please contact agency at (530) 225-8979 for more information on their program.

 

CITY OF REDDING MINOR HOME REPAIR PROGRAM FOR SENIORS

Must be 60 or older, pays up to $300 worth of repairs. Call (530) 245-7136 for more information. Must be income eligible. See HUD income guidelines.

 

SHASTA COUNTY COMMUNITY ACTION AGENCY

Minor home repairs for seniors 60 and over or physically disabled. Call (530) 225-5160. County or outside city limits.

 

ANDERSON AREA SENIOR CITIZEN PROJECT

Helps seniors with minor home repair and modifications.  Owner provides materials; the program provides labor. Call (530) 378-6656 Monday - Friday from 8-5pm.
